Anthopoulos pulled off some great trades, but they were made out of desperation by a lame-duck GM, who knew he was in a contract year. His trading, while bringing in stars like Donaldson, Price and Tulo, left us without some of our best prospects

Do you understand how many prospects completely bust? I'll hang up and wait for the answer.

While he was a good GM (somehow getting rid of Reyes comes to mind), it is not the end of the world that Alex Anthopoulos is no longer the GM of the Toronto Blue Jays.

I'll wait for you to say that after the Jays do a post-1994 Expos bloodletting. The only reason you give a guy like Shapiro full control over baseball operations in 2015 is if you want to cut your budget, hard.

Edit: I mean, a company like Rogers could theoretically have an unlimited payroll, but the only explanation for bringing Mark Shapiro in to be AA's boss is if you're pissed off about the payroll expansion and you want to shave costs from everything. That's what the dude does.

Prospects do bust, but these were prospects who even been before hitting the majors were showing greatness. I was and am still not a fan of the Dickey trade and giving up two sure-fire prospects, one of which is now a star pitcher of a World Series finalist. Hoffman was another one of these pitchers who are destined for greatness.

I personally believe Rogers was going to give him control over player moves. He only left because it wasn't going to be the control he had under Beeston, which was "call me when you need money." I can't think of one team where the general manager doesn't have to report to someone before making a trade and I think AA bristled at having to suddenly ask someone to review his trades before he made them. We're never going to get the real answer to this as everyone decides to take the high road.

At least the Mets got to win one game.

But it was another case of one team matching up way better to the other. The Cubs were 7-0 vs. the Mets in the regular season, but then the Mets gelled as a team and made some additions by the post-season and the Cubs forgot what made them a great team in the 2nd half.

Despite leading the league in strikeouts, the Cubs had that patience thing going for them where they could get a good starter out of the game just by getting him to throw 90 pitches by the 4th inning. Maybe they scored some runs in there, maybe they didn't.

Plus some of the big regular season bats went ice cold in the post-season (mainly Bryant & Rizzo).
